ABOVE:  The Racine Veteran's Firing Squad marching off in Racine's 2007 Memorial Day parade.  What most, if not all, of
the current Racine Kilties (seen in the background waiting to march in the parade) probably don't realize is that the Racine
Veteran's Firing Squad Captain, above middle with the pistol holster, is Harald Kahlert, the Racine Kilties first drum major
from way back in 1936.  Harald was an original member of the Kilties.  Harald joined the Kilties when they organized in the
fall of 1934 as a snare drummer.  Harald told me that he thought that the reason he was made the Kilties first drum major
was because he was very tall.
BELOW:  Kiltie Alumni Dan Fornero was the featured guest trumpet soloist with Racine's Belle City Brassworks brass band at
a concert held on Sunday, November 11, 2007.  This article appeared in the Racine Journal Times, Thursday, November 08,
2007.  The Belle City Brassworks was founded by Kiltie Jr. Corps Alumni Gary King and Ken Norman in the late 1980's.
